Why are many lakes in the Eastern Mediterranean very salty and full of minerals?
A.
The earth around them has higher than normal levels of salt and minerals.
B.
They have no outlets to the ocean, and the minerals have built up over time.
C.
They lie below sea level.
D.
The nearby Mediterranean Sea is extremely alkaline.

B. They have no outlets to the ocean, so dissolved minerals brought in by rivers and runoff remain and become concentrated by evaporation.
